Newar Buddhist devotees worship Dipankara Buddha during the Panchadaan festival in Bhaktapur, Nepal, on August 21, 2025. Known as the festival of five summer gifts, Panchadaan is a sacred ritual where devotees offer five traditional alms in monastic courtyards and community squares.(Photo by Safal Prakash Shrestha/ZUMA Press Wire/Rex Features/Shutterstock)

A Naga sadhu, or Hindu holy man, rests at the Pashupatinath temple complex in Kathmandu on August 27, 2025. Nepal’s Supreme Court ruled that the ascetics’ traditional practice of nudity is not obscenity and that they need not wear clothes at the temple.(Photo by Prakash Mathema/AFP Photo)
